She did her Masters in Functional Genomics and Proteomics, between Lebanon and France, followed by a doctoral journey in Belgium in the lab of Franck Dequiedt. During her PhD, Zahrat worked on the control of mRNA translation. Her fascination with ribosomes led her to the Karbstein lab, where she is currently studying ribosome assembly and quality control. When not in the lab, Zahrat cherishes family gatherings, enjoys learning to swim, and loves diving into books from all genres.<\/p>\n<\/p><ul><li> <i class=\"fa fa-envelope\" aria-hidden=\"true\"><\/i>: <a href=\"mailto:zahrat.el.oula.hassoun@vanderbilt.edu\"> zahrat.el.oula.hassoun@vanderbilt.edu<\/a><\/li><\/ul><\/div><hr \/><\/div><br \/>\n<h2>Graduate Students<\/h2><div class=\"media\"> <div class=\"media-left\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/katie-jo-gelasco\/\"><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/cdn.vanderbilt.edu\/t2-main\/lab-prd\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/221\/2026\/03\/Gelasco_Katie-Jo_cropped_400pix-108x144.png\" alt=\"image_thumb\" \/><\/a><\/div><div class=\"media-body\"><h3 class=\"media-heading\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/katie-jo-gelasco\/\">Katie Jo   Gelasco<\/a><\/h3><p class=\"person-title\"><\/p><p><p>After entering Vanderbilt through the QCB program, Katie Jo joined the lab in April 2025, where she studies remodeling of the ribosome under stress conditions. She earned a B.A. in music and B.S. in biochemistry from Florida State University in 2024. Her undergraduate research focused on engineering CRISPR-Cas9 proteins for structural studies in Dr. Hong Li\u2019s lab. When not in the lab, Katie Jo enjoys reading, playing cello, and exploring Nashville with friends.<\/p>\n<\/p><ul><li> <i class=\"fa fa-envelope\" aria-hidden=\"true\"><\/i>: <a href=\"mailto:mary.katherine.j.gelasco@vanderbilt.edu\"> mary.katherine.j.gelasco@vanderbilt.edu<\/a><\/li><\/ul><\/div><hr \/><\/div><br \/>\n<h2>Technicians<\/h2><div class=\"media\"> <div class=\"media-left\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/daniel-gatewood\/\"><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/cdn.vanderbilt.edu\/t2-main\/lab-prd\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/221\/2026\/03\/Gatewood_Daniel_400pix-108x144.png\" alt=\"image_thumb\" \/><\/a><\/div><div class=\"media-body\"><h3 class=\"media-heading\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/daniel-gatewood\/\">Daniel  Gatewood<\/a><\/h3><p class=\"person-title\">Technician, Department of Biochemsitry<br \/><\/p><p><p>Daniel received his BS\u00a0in Biochemistry from the University of Notre Dame where he investigated co-translocational folding of beta helical domains in the lab of Dr. Patricia Clark. He is most interested in processes that regulate protein and proteome structure and function as well as the potential to engineer such systems for novel aims. In the Karbstein lab he studies translational and ribosomal adaptation under zinc deprivation. In his free time he is a big film buff and likes to stay active through hiking, weightlifting, and sand volleyball.<\/p>\n<\/p><ul><li> <i class=\"fa fa-envelope\" aria-hidden=\"true\"><\/i>: <a href=\"mailto:daniel.j.gatewood@vanderbilt.edu\"> daniel.j.gatewood@vanderbilt.edu<\/a><\/li><\/ul><\/div><hr \/><\/div><div class=\"media\"> <div class=\"media-left\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/xiaozhu-zhang\/\"><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/cdn.vanderbilt.edu\/t2-main\/lab-prd\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/221\/2024\/11\/Zhang_Xiaozhu_400pix-108x144.jpg\" alt=\"image_thumb\" \/><\/a><\/div><div class=\"media-body\"><h3 class=\"media-heading\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/xiaozhu-zhang\/\">Xiaozhu   Zhang<\/a><\/h3><p class=\"person-title\">Research Specialist, Department of Biochemistry<br \/><\/p><ul><li> <i class=\"fa fa-envelope\" aria-hidden=\"true\"><\/i>: <a href=\"mailto:xiaozhu.zhang@Vanderbilt.Edu\"> xiaozhu.zhang@Vanderbilt.Edu<\/a><\/li><\/ul><\/div><hr \/><\/div><br \/>\n<h2>Undergraduate Students<\/h2><div class=\"media\"> <div class=\"media-left\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/isaiah-desta\/\"><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/cdn.vanderbilt.edu\/t2-main\/lab-prd\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/221\/2025\/02\/Desta_Isaiah_400pix-108x144.jpg\" alt=\"image_thumb\" \/><\/a><\/div><div class=\"media-body\"><h3 class=\"media-heading\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/isaiah-desta\/\">Isaiah   Desta<\/a><\/h3><p class=\"person-title\">Undergraduate Student<br \/><\/p><ul><li> <i class=\"fa fa-envelope\" aria-hidden=\"true\"><\/i>: <a href=\"mailto:isaiah.h.desta@vanderbilt.edu\"> isaiah.h.desta@vanderbilt.edu<\/a><\/li><\/ul><\/div><hr \/><\/div><div class=\"media\"> <div class=\"media-left\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/sophia-jiang\/\"><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/cdn.vanderbilt.edu\/t2-main\/lab-prd\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/221\/2026\/03\/Jiang_Sophia_cropped_400pix-108x144.png\" alt=\"image_thumb\" \/><\/a><\/div><div class=\"media-body\"><h3 class=\"media-heading\"><a href=\"https:\/\/lab.vanderbilt.edu\/karbstein-lab\/person\/sophia-jiang\/\">Sophia  Jiang<\/a><\/h3><p class=\"person-title\">Undergraduate Student<br \/><\/p><p><p>Sophia is an undergraduate student at Vanderbilt University (Class of 2028) majoring in Biochemistry. She previously conducted research with Dr. Shenglong Zhang, where she worked on de novo RNA sequencing using mass spectrometry. In the Karbstein lab, she investigates cellular responses to zinc deprivation by studying the role of Rps26 as a potential zinc reservoir. Outside the lab, Sophia is a competitive figure skater and coach, and she enjoys crocheting and giving back through volunteer work.<\/p>\n<\/p><ul><li> <i class=\"fa fa-envelope\" aria-hidden=\"true\"><\/i>: <a href=\"mailto:sophia.jiang@vanderbilt.edu\"> sophia.jiang@vanderbilt.edu<\/a><\/li><\/ul><\/div><hr \/><\/div><\/p>\n<h4>ALUMNI<\/h4>\n<p><strong>FORMER POSTDOCS<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Dr. Yoon-Mo Yang (TSRI, 11\/2018-07\/2023); now: Assistant Professor, Hanyang University, Korea<br \/>\n<a href=\"https:\/\/med.emory.edu\/departments\/biochemistry\/research-labs\/khoshnevis\/team.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">Dr. Sohail Khoshnevis<\/a> (TSRI, 04\/2012-06\/2018); now: Assistant Professor, Emory University<br \/>\n<a href=\"https:\/\/med.emory.edu\/departments\/biochemistry\/research-labs\/ghalei\/people.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">Dr. Homa Ghalei<\/a> (TSRI, 04\/2012-10\/2017); now: Associate Professor, Emory University<br \/>\nDr. Jason Collins (TSRI, 10\/2015-08\/2017); now: Postdoctoral Researcher, NIH, NIDCR Director\u2019s Diversity Fellowship Recipient<br \/>\nDr. Miriam Koch (TSRI, 10\/2016-08\/2017); now: Janssen Vaccines AG, Switzerland<br \/>\nDr. Hari Bhaskaran (TSRI, 05\/2013-08\/2014); now: Arcturus Therapeutics, San Diego<br \/>\nDr. Juliette Trepreau, (TSRI, 01\/2012-06\/2013); now: Project Leader in Molecular and Cell Biology, CIMTECH, Universite de Marseilles<br \/>\nDr. Boguslawa Korona (TSRI, 08\/2011-02\/2012); now: Oxford University<br \/>\nDr. Darryl M.
